Ambient Leadership & Automated People Dynamics
Economics studies the management and flow of resources. When you highlight people and influence as our precious resources, you leverage effective ways to flow these into positive results. This leadership course allows you to build broader, “ambient” influence in nearly-“automated” ways. This approach reflects an economic view, emphasizing minimal input with maximum impact. Topics include:
- Economics of Reputation & Context: Develop skills that systematically form a broader context of relationships and social environment toward building a stronger reputation.
- Relationships, Mind & Matter: Rather than “mind over matter,” when it comes to influence, both the mental and physical matter. Understanding key concepts like Embodied Cognition and Relationship Typologies will help maximize mutual success among you and your colleagues.
- Championship & Followership: How can you serve as a Champion and Follower to achieve impact and high performance? Leverage models and tactics to champion and follow effectively—a powerful leadership combination!
